The Small Industries Development Bank of India (SIDBI) has expanded its knowledge-sharing initiative, SIDBI MSME Samvaad, with the release of Episodes 7 and 8, aimed at helping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) strengthen their understanding of sustainability, green finance and government support mechanisms. The latest editions of the series are designed to provide practical guidance to entrepreneurs as India’s MSME ecosystem increasingly adapts to changing market dynamics and policy priorities.
The initiative seeks to simplify complex business concepts through expert-led discussions, making valuable information more accessible to business owners across the country. To ensure wider outreach, the programme is being telecast in multiple regional languages, enabling entrepreneurs from diverse linguistic backgrounds to benefit from the sessions.
Sustainability Takes Centre Stage
Episode 7 highlights the growing significance of sustainable business practices and the role of green finance in driving long-term enterprise growth. The discussion examines how MSMEs can adopt environmentally responsible practices while maintaining competitiveness and improving financial resilience.
The expert featured in the episode explains that sustainability is no longer viewed merely as a compliance requirement but has emerged as a strategic business priority. Businesses that embrace environmentally friendly practices are increasingly finding opportunities to improve operational efficiency, attract investment and strengthen their market position.
The episode also discusses financing options available for green initiatives, helping entrepreneurs understand how they can access funds to support environmentally sustainable projects. It addresses common challenges that MSMEs may face while transitioning towards greener operations and outlines the long-term benefits of investing in sustainable technologies and processes.
By encouraging businesses to integrate environmental responsibility into their growth strategies, the session underlines the importance of balancing economic development with ecological sustainability.
Building Awareness of Government Support
Episode 8 focuses on enhancing entrepreneurs’ understanding of government policies and support programmes designed for the MSME sector. It explores how awareness of various schemes, subsidies, skill development initiatives, quality certification assistance and market access programmes can help businesses make informed strategic decisions.
The discussion emphasises that many MSMEs fail to fully utilise available government support due to limited awareness or difficulty navigating policy frameworks. The featured expert explains how entrepreneurs can identify schemes most relevant to their business needs and effectively leverage them for expansion and competitiveness.
The episode also provides practical guidance on overcoming challenges associated with accessing government benefits, encouraging business owners to remain updated on policy developments that could influence their growth opportunities.
